Protesters stayed in the streets for nearly two months, with marches taking place almost every day in major cities. People in Cali protest against a tax reform bill they say will leave them poorer - proposals that have since been dropped. Photograph: Luis Robayo/AFP/GettyThe police response was brutal, with at least 44 protesters killed and 1,650 injured across the country. While the initial spark for the protests has gone, protesters say they are still being intimidated.
